Unlike the women's team which seems to be a bit of a mess, the men's team has a well established pecking order. The rotations will tighten up against tougher competition. I figured today would be the Jubrile Belo dunk show, but that didn't really happen until the second half. They did a good job of triple teaming him in the first half and beating the heck out of him. It was good for Belo-he needs to keep working to play through it. Refs call ticky tacky on the perimeter but the big guy gets mauled. Credit to Rocky who played their butts off. Their coach worked it like a final four.

Other than Patterson and Mohamed we couldn't get many threes to fall. Battle and Gazeles missed a bunch of them, but there will be games when those will go down-better when we really need them.

Battle's athleticism is amazing-definitely a notch above what we usually see in the Big Sky. He just needs to work on becoming a better basketball player. But he's only a sophomore. I feel like we're really set up to be good for a long time.

Germer, Reinalada, and Fernandez were in street clothes. I am assuming they are redshirting. I think Fernandez is/was coming back from an injury.

Love hearing this. Keep on reporting on your Bobcat adventures. The Brick has a lot of history there. It opened up in 1956 and has been adapted very well over the years. It’s my favorite man-made place to walk into, ever. Lots and lots of basketball, but also College Championship rodeo, track (I believe Montana’s first four-minute mile), field (watching Ellie Rudy winning pole vaults and then on to two NCAA National Championships), little league baseball, 6,000 people attending a ‘Cat/griz volleyball game, and just last weekend the High School 4-Class State Volleyball tournament with four courts playing simultaneously. It’s seen it all. Enjoy it.
